Certified Professional in Inventory Management Career Roles (UK) Description
Inventory Control Specialist Manages inventory levels, minimizing waste and maximizing efficiency. Focuses on inventory optimization and reduction of storage costs.
Supply Chain Analyst (Inventory Management) Analyzes the entire supply chain, focusing on inventory flow and forecasting demand to optimize inventory levels. Key skills include forecasting and data analysis.
Warehouse Manager (Inventory Focus) Oversees warehouse operations with a strong emphasis on inventory control, storage optimization, and efficient order fulfillment. Experience in warehouse management systems is crucial.
Procurement and Inventory Manager Responsible for sourcing materials and managing inventory levels throughout the entire procurement process. Key skills include negotiation and supplier relationship management.
